The deck lift/lower switch is used to raise and lower the cutting deck on later
machines. The switch is located on the control panel
The engine must be running to allow the cutting deck to be raised or lowered.
When the front of the lift switch is pressed, the deck will lower fully. When the
rear of the lift switch is pressed and held, the deck will raise. When raising the
deck, the deck will remain in position if the switch is released.
When the rear of the lift/lower switch is pressed, both of the solenoid valve coils
(SV1 and SV2) on the hydraulic lift control valve are energized causing the
valves to shift and the lift cylinder to extend to raise the cutting deck. When the
front of the lift/lower switch is pressed, solenoid valve coil (SV2) on the hydraulic
lift control valve is energized causing the valve to shift and the lift cylinder to
retract to lower the cutting deck.
